In this episode of the Bookaholic Podcast, host Deirdre Pippins speaks with debut thriller novelist Patsy Robertson about her new book 'A Concoction of Lies.' Patsy shares her journey from working in the technology field to becoming an author during the COVID-19 pandemic. She discusses the transition process and the challenges of learning the writing and publishing industry. Patsy's novel features mature characters and is set in multicultural settings, including Guatemala and Belize. She reflects on the importance of representing African American family ties beyond the Americas and gives insights into her creative process. Patsy also reveals details about her upcoming second book, which will be set in Trinidad and Tobago.
